Valve size Available trim Cv in mm ASME 150, 300, 600 1 25 2 4 6 1 1/2 40 9 15 2 50 16 25 3 80 22 30 4 100 40 75 100 6 150 75 130 175 8 200 200 350 10 250 420 550 Series 1200 Globe Valves 07 Noise & cavitation control As a fluid passes through a restriction, such as the trim in a valve, a pressure reduction and subsequent velocity increase takes place. The point of lowest pressure and highest velocity that occurs immediately after the restriction is called the vena contracta, after which the pressure recovers and the fluid velocity is reduced. The trim design has a great influence on the amount of recovery. In the case of liquids, if the pressure at the vena contracta goes below the liquid s vapour pressure, bubbles are formed.

9 If the subsequent pressure recovery to P2 (downstream pressure) exceeds the fluid s vapour pressure the vapour bubble collapses or implodes so called cavitation. This can occur within the valve, or in the downstream pipe work. The energy dissipated can cause extensive damage to both the valve and the pipe work. If the pressure recovery stays below the fluid s vapour pressure then flashing occurs. Multi-stage pressure let down or anti-cavitation valve trim designs enable the required pressure drop across the valve to be achieved in a number of stages as illustrated in above velocity of the fluid through the valve has a major influence on the erosive effect of the fluid on the valve body and trim, so the control of fluid velocity and the appropriate selection of materials is critical to the valve PERFORMANCE and service life. Higher fluid velocities, particularly in gas service, can generate noise in the valve and pipe work thus velocity control is major factor in containing noise emissions within acceptable limits (normally <85 dBA).
